Riverbed Technology, Inc.

  • Technical Director / Principal Engineer

    Job Locations US-CA-Sunnyvale
    Req No.
    2018-4544
    Category
    Engineering
  • Company Overview

    With a powerful combination of Digital Experience, Cloud Networking, and Cloud Edge solutions, Riverbed – The Digital Performance Company –  provides a modern IT architecture for the digital enterprise, delivering new levels of operational agility and visibility, while dramatically accelerating business performance and outcomes. As businesses transform digitally and experiment with new technologies, they partner with Riverbed to push boundaries, increase performance, and rethink possible.

     

    Riverbed is a pre-IPO opportunity with over $1 billion in revenue and 30,000+ customers – including 98% of the Fortune 100 and 100% of the Forbes Global 100.

    About this Position

     

    Technical Director / Principal Engineer

     

    Responsibilities:

    • Research various technologies and solutions as you design new features for our existing products.
    • Opportunity to work with the many other great engineering teams across Riverbed to ensure our solutions all work together.
    • Thrive on customer and support contact.  Our team works closely with customers and support engineers to resolve existing issues as well as how our product could be improved for our wide variety of customers.

     

    Qualifications:

    • BE/BTech or ME/Mtech in CS from reputed institute/college/university
    • Strong C/C++ programming experience with strong debugging skills
    • Understanding of multi-threaded programming environments
    • Minimum 7 years’ experience in user-facing application/enterprise development
    • A computer science background (BS or Masters)
    • Fluency in JavaScript and experience with basic frameworks such as YUI, jQuery, etc. is required
    • Perl or Python are required  
    • Experience with browser-side MVC and modern templating frameworks such as Angular, Polymer, React, Backbone, Handlebars, etc is important 
    • Solid backend design experience
    • Automation experience is plus

     

    Additional desirable qualifications:

    • Knowledge of scripting languages such as Perl or Python
    • Experience with networking and security protocols
    • Work with high performance distributed systems and databases
    • Experience with REST, web development skills including HTML and Javascript
    • Experience with appliance configuration management and clustering technologies
    • System level programming and platform knowledge

    About Riverbed

    If you are a high-achiever who wants to be part of a dynamically growing, billion dollar plus company, then you should look closely at Riverbed.  We offer the rewarding experience of working with the best minds in the industry that are changing the world through cutting edge technology and applications. The company has been recognized multiple years for attracting and retaining today’s top talent as a great place to work by Glassdoor, Fortune magazine’s 20 Great Workplaces in Tech and by numerous other publications.

     

    Learn more at www.riverbed.com. 

     

    Riverbed is proud to be an affirmative action (AA) and equal employment opportunities (EEO) employer.  All qualified applicants will receive consideration for employment without regard to race, sex, color, religion, sexual orientation, gender identity, national origin, protected veteran status, or on the basis of disability.

     

    *LI-JB1

    Options

    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
    Share on your newsfeed

    Connect With Us!

    Don't see the ideal job for you posted today? Connect with us for general consideration for future opportunities at Riverbed.